  1. Walter Wanderley / ˈ v ɒ n d ər l eɪ / (born Walter Jose Wanderley Mendonça, May 12, 1932 – September 4, 1986) was a Brazilian organist and pianist, best known for his lounge and bossa nova music and for his instrumental version of the song Summer Samba which became a worldwide hit.

  5. Walter Wanderley (May 12, 1932, Recife, Brazil - September 4, 1986, San Francisco, USA) was a Brazilian pianist, organist and arranger. He moved to São Paulo in 1947 where he reportedly learned to play organ with his aunt and also studied harmony at Lyceu de Artes.
